Really good, really unique. I had never had Ethiopian food, but we went out with (vegetarian) friends who recommended it, and we're always game for something new. Super-friendly owner and waitstaff. The food was super tasty and lots of fun. I decided to pass on the meat dishes and go veggie like our friends did, and we had a wonderful array of stews. I ordered the vegetarian was terrific. A couple of lentil dishes, chickpeas, split yellow peas, string beans w/carrots & onions, and a potato/cabbage mix. Really tasty, and fun to pick up the stews with the injera (kind of like a firmer crepe/pancake. Reminded me of eating a mix of Moroccan, Lebanese and Indian foods. So good. The iced black tea (with cinnamon, cardamom & cloves) is a great accompaniment. We'll be back.
